FOREX Day Trading
A second market to consider is the FOREX market. It is almost as cheap to trade as an EMINI, can also allow a trader to make money in both directions, but offers a far greater market choice and far larger trading opportunity. Let me explain.
Trading ''FOREX'', or Foreign Exchange, is a process of trading one currency against another, just like when you go for a holiday overseas. Currency is generally traded in pairs, say for example, the Japanese Yen (Yen) versus the United States Dollar (USD). Fact is, there are many hundreds of currencies and hence thousands of possible currency pairs. This results in a massive international market and trading opportunity every trading day. The world markets currently turn over more than $3 Trillion USD worth of liquidity (or trading opportunity) during a typical FOREX trading day.
4. What does it take to learn a strategy and is a “system to follow” important?
Learning a strategy takes a steady hand and the ability to control your emotions. That, in itself, is no small feat, but emotions (specifically greed) are one of the toughest obstacles every trader must master. Smart traders who are keen to be successful will always systemise their trading as much as they can by looking for a well defined signal set, on a specific chart, and they will always do this under the supervision of a professional trader or trading team.
Once a strategy has been tested and has proven successful it serves as a great foundation for a trading system. Systemising your signal set and trading strategy allows you to inject a degree of certainty into your trading. How you might ask? A good signal set will tell you exactly when to get into the market and where to get back out. This kind mechanical exit and entry has a very positive effect on your trading psychology as it helps to limit your emotions while trading. The more mechanical you can make your trading the better.
